Carved, 3D wooden wall plaque depicting one of Mira Fujita pierrot clowns.  

Mira Fujita is a Japanese-French artist known for her distinctive style, which often features ethereal and dreamlike imagery. Mira Fujita is known for her art featuring Pierrot, a character from the Commedia dell'arte tradition. The Pierrot series is one of her most iconic and recognizable bodies of work.

Pierrot is a stock character in the Commedia dell'arte, a form of Italian theater that originated in the 16th century. Pierrot is often portrayed as a sad or romantic clown. In Fujita's paintings featuring Pierrot, she captures the melancholic and poetic essence of the character. The figures are often portrayed in dreamlike and surreal settings, reflecting Fujita's unique blend of Eastern and Western artistic influences. The use of Pierrot in her art allows her to explore themes of love, tragedy, and the human condition in a way that resonates with viewers.
